Payo De Ojeda, a region nestled within Palencia, Spain, offers a diverse landscape for outdoor activities. Situated in a picturesque valley at approximately 1000 meters above sea level, the area features a blend of coniferous forests and ancient oak groves, with the Payo River and Villavega stream adding to its natural character. Its proximity to the Montaña Palentina Natural Park provides access to varied terrain suitable for several sports like hiking, road cycling, touring cycling, and mountain biking.

The area around Payo De Ojeda, particularly in the nearby Montaña Palentina Natural Park, offers diverse hiking options. These include routes through ancient yew and beech forests, such as the Tejeda de Tosande Trail, and more challenging ascents like the Peña Redonda Ascent Trail.
